Warlock and titans have heals and attack buffs/shields respectively. Hunters have dodge roll. At first it seems hunters don't have much in terms of support, but you'll eventually be able to debuff bosses and turn you and your allies invisible. I even saw someone using their dodge roll to bait large enemies attacks by rolling through their melee while the rest Dps. I like healing so I chose warlock cuz I like heals but they all have neat tricks.
On the offensive side, warlocks are space magicy stuff like area of effect damage and fast self heals and super recharging. Titans are defensive and bruce force offensive. Hunters have more tricky and unique effects to help them like anchoring enemies, increase backstab melee strength, massive single shot bursts. They all have advantages and they're all stylish.
